# Title: The galaxy ultraviolet luminosity function from z=7 to 15 in the COLIBRE simulations

# Authors: Shengdong Lu, Carlos S. Frenk, Cedric G. Lacey, Andrea Gebek, Joop Schaye, Shaun Cole, Sownak Bose,
#          Anna Durrant, Nick Andreadis, Maarten Baes, Alejandro Benítez-Llambay, Evgenii Chaikin, Camila Correa,
#          Robert A. Crain, Filip Huško, Robert J. McGibbon, Sylvia Ploeckinger, Alexander J. Richings,
#          Matthieu Schaller, James W. Trayford

#================================================================================================================================================================================================
# This dataset compiles UV luminosity function (UVLF) measurements from the literature, including values reported in tables and values extracted from figures.
# For convenience, all measurements have been converted into a unified format, with MUV given as AB absolute magnitude and logPhi given in log10(Mpc^-3 mag^-1).
# Apart from these unit conversions and formatting changes, no additional corrections have been applied. Readers should refer to the original publications for the raw
# data and detailed measurement methodology. Below, we provide an explanation of the parameters in each column.
#================================================================================================================================================================================================
# Parameter             Unit                  Description
#------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------
# h                                           Dimensionless Hubble parameter reported in the reference; defined as h = H0 / (100 km s^-1 Mpc^-1).
# JWST observation                            True if the measurement is based on JWST observations; False otherwise.
# MUV                   mag                   UV magnitude bin centre for the galaxy abundance measurement; if no bin range is provided, this is treated as a single-point value.
# MUV_upper             mag                   Upper/brighter boundary of the UV magnitude bin; identical to MUV if no MUV range is provided.
# MUV_lower             mag                   Lower/fainter boundary of the UV magnitude bin; identical to MUV if no MUV range is provided.
# logPhi                log10(Mpc^-3 mag^-1)  Galaxy number density in the UV magnitude bin, in log10 units.
# logPhi_upper          log10(Mpc^-3 mag^-1)  Upper value of the galaxy number density measurement, in log10 units; set to NaN if the measurement is an upper or lower limit.
# logPhi_lower          log10(Mpc^-3 mag^-1)  Lower value of the galaxy number density measurement, in log10 units; set to NaN if the measurement is an upper or lower limit.
# z                                           Representative redshift assigned to the UVLF measurement by the original reference; if not provided, we use the centre of the quoted redshift bin.
# z_upper                                     Upper boundary of the redshift bin; set to NaN if no redshift range is provided.
# z_lower                                     Lower boundary of the redshift bin; set to NaN if no redshift range is provided.
# UpperLimit                                  1: the measurement is labelled as an upper limit; 0: not an upper limit.
# LowerLimit                                  1: the measurement is labelled as a lower limit; 0: not a lower limit.
# Spec-z-confirmed                            1: the measurement is treated as spectroscopic or spectroscopically constrained; 0: otherwise.
#================================================================================================================================================================================================
